Smartedge’s Client is looking for a skilled Python Developer (Consultant) with experience in power systems automation to create a tool for transforming PSS/E .raw files into Power Factory node-breaker models. The role includes:
- Parsing, data mapping, GUI/CLI development, automation of load flow simulations, and structured output generation.
- Interpreting and validating PSS/E .raw file content for accurate power system representation.
- Developing Python scripts to parse .raw files (PSS/E format) and extract BUS, LOAD, GEN, IBR, and transformer data.
- Designing and implementing conversion logic for mapping bus-branch data to node-breaker format.
- Using Power Factory Python API to automate model creation, P/Q assignment, and topology setup.
- Implementing load flow simulation automation and parsing results into structured formats (CSV/JSON).
- Developing a lightweight GUI or CLI for selecting input files, triggering conversions, and displaying logs.
- Handling error reporting, convergence failures, and terminal mismatches during simulation.
- Packaging scripts into .exe format for Windows 10/11 deployment.
- Providing detailed user and developer documentation.
